  • Govind Prasad Kukreti (25 August 1932 – 31 August 2016), popularly known as Dabral Baba, was an Indian yogi and a disciple of Vikrant Bhairav and Mahavatar Babaji. He was also known as Baba and Shri Dabral Baba. Dabral Baba hailed from Ujjain in the state of Madhya Pradesh. He adopted his surname (Dabral) after his maternal uncle's who virtually brought him up at Dhar and later to Ujjain. He was also unusual among Indian yogis who was a householder - he got married, raised a family, worked in Vikram University in Ujjain. Dabral Baba lived with his family at his home (Bhairav Niwas) located in Rishinagar in Ujjain. Dabral Baba attainted substantial enlightenment and earned popularity among highest ranks of yogis in 20th and 21st century period. In the later part of his life, he was visited by many great saints both physically and spiritually primarily Mahavatar Babaji who took him to his gupha as well. Dabral Baba unveiled Vikrant Bhairav temple in Bhairavgarh, Madhya Pradesh the idol of Vikrant Bhairav was deep buried in mud for years, Dabral Baba was guided to unveil this temple and he later attained enlightenment with the guidance of his guru.
